NASA's Efforts to Monitor and Mitigate Asteroid Threats

NASA, along with other space agencies worldwide, is constantly monitoring the skies for near-Earth objects (NEOs), including asteroids and comets. They utilize sophisticated telescopes and tracking systems to detect, track, and predict the trajectories of these celestial bodies. The agency has developed various strategies to mitigate the risk of asteroid impacts, ranging from early warning systems to potential deflection technologies.
